About The Role!
The Inventory Manager is the single point of ownership for inventory accuracy, visibility, and control across the warehouse. This role ensures that physical stock and system stock are always aligned, discrepancies are proactively identified, and inventory is always outbound-ready.
The role acts as the control tower between inbound and outbound operations, preventing losses, delays, and customer escalations.

Job Responsibilities
1. Inventory Ownership & Accuracy
Own overall inventory accuracy across all storage locations
Ensure system inventory matches physical stock at all times
Monitor and control inventory movements (inbound, putaway, picking, returns, adjustments)
Approve and control all inventory adjustments
2. Cycle Counts & Audits
Design and execute cycle count programs (daily / weekly / monthly)
Lead full physical stock counts when required
Investigate discrepancies and perform root cause analysis
Ensure corrective actions are implemented and sustained
3. Inventory Control & Loss Prevention
Identify and reduce shrinkage, damages, and write-offs
Enforce access control and inventory handling discipline
Work closely with Security, Quality, and Operations teams
Flag high-risk SKUs and merchants proactively
4. System & Data Management
Ensure accurate SKU setup, bin locations, and barcode usage
Maintain strong discipline in WMS transactions
Own inventory dashboards and reporting
Support WMS enhancements and integrations
5. Cross-Functional Coordination
Work closely with Inbound Manager on receiving accuracy
Align with Outbound Manager to reduce pick-related variances
Support Account Management on inventory-related escalations
Act as the neutral decision-maker between teams
6. Process Improvement & SOP Governance
Define, enforce, and continuously improve inventory SOPs
Close operational gaps between inbound, storage, and outbound
Train teams on inventory handling best practices
Support compliance and audit readiness
7. Team Leadership & Development
Lead and develop Inventory Supervisors and Coordinators
Set clear KPIs and accountability frameworks
Build a culture of accuracy and ownership
Ensure coverage and continuity across shifts
KPIs & Success Metrics
Inventory accuracy (%)
Shrinkage / loss rate
Adjustment value and frequency
Cycle count completion rate
Root cause resolution time
Inventory-related outbound errors
Audit pass rate
